Mengonfigurasi Pengaturan Indentasi di Excel
Perkenalan
Membuat dan mengelola spreadsheet secara terprogram dapat menghemat banyak waktu dan kerepotan, terutama dengan pustaka seperti Aspose.Cells untuk .NET. Hari ini, kita akan menyelami lebih dalam konfigurasi pengaturan indentasi di Excel menggunakan pustaka yang canggih ini. Indentasi dalam sel dapat meningkatkan keterbacaan dan pengaturan data Anda, menyediakan hierarki dan hubungan yang jelas dalam konten Anda. Jadi, apakah Anda seorang pengembang yang ingin meningkatkan otomatisasi Excel atau hanya ingin menambahkan sedikit gaya pada spreadsheet Anda, Anda berada di tempat yang tepat!
Prasyarat
Sebelum kita masuk ke detail teknis, mari kita bahas apa saja yang perlu Anda siapkan sebelum kita mulai menulis skrip:
- Visual Studio: Pastikan Visual Studio telah terinstal di komputer Anda. Di sinilah kita akan menulis dan mengeksekusi kode.
- Aspose.Cells untuk .NET: Unduh pustaka Aspose.Cells. Anda dapatunduh disini.
- Pemahaman Dasar tentang C#: Keakraban dengan pemrograman C# dan kerangka kerja .NET akan membantu Anda memahami contoh yang akan kita bahas.
- .NET Framework: Pastikan proyek Anda diatur untuk bekerja dengan versi .NET Framework yang didukung oleh Aspose.Cells. Setelah Anda menyelesaikan semuanya, kita siap untuk memulai!
Paket Impor
Langkah pertama dalam perjalanan kita adalah mengimpor namespace yang diperlukan untuk memanfaatkan pustaka Aspose.Cells. Langkah ini mudah, dan berikut cara melakukannya.
Langkah 1: Impor Namespace Aspose.Cells
Untuk mulai menggunakan Aspose.Cells, Anda perlu menyertakan namespace-nya di bagian atas file C# Anda:
using System.IO;
using Aspose.Cells;
Hal ini memungkinkan Anda untuk mengakses semua kelas dan metode yang disediakan oleh pustaka tanpa perlu menentukan jalur lengkap setiap saat. Jika Anda perlu, silakan periksa informasi lebih lanjut didokumentasi. Sekarang, mari kita bahas tugas membuat file Excel dan menambahkan beberapa indentasi di sel. Saya akan memandu Anda langkah demi langkah melalui seluruh proses.
Langkah 2: Siapkan Direktori Dokumen
Pertama, kita perlu tempat untuk menyimpan berkas Excel kita. Mari kita tentukan direktori dokumen kita.
string dataDir = "Your Document Directory";
Pada baris ini, ganti “Direktori Dokumen Anda” dengan jalur sebenarnya tempat Anda ingin menyimpan file Excel. Ingat, pengaturan yang baik membantu Anda mengelola file dengan lebih baik!
Langkah 3: Buat Direktori Jika Tidak Ada
Sebelum membuat buku kerja, kita akan memeriksa apakah direktori yang ditentukan ada. Jika tidak, kita dapat membuatnya dengan cepat.
bool IsExists = System.IO.Directory.Exists(dataDir);
if (!IsExists)
System.IO.Directory.CreateDirectory(dataDir);
Cuplikan ini memastikan bahwa Anda tidak akan mengalami kesalahan saat mencoba menyimpan berkas Anda nanti.
Langkah 4: Membuat Instansiasi Objek Buku Kerja
Selanjutnya, mari kita buat buku kerja Excel yang sebenarnya. Di sinilah data Anda akan berada.
Workbook workbook = new Workbook();
Dengan baris ini, buku kerja baru dibuat, dan Anda dapat langsung mulai mengeditnya!
Langkah 5: Dapatkan Lembar Kerja
Setelah kita memiliki buku kerja, kita perlu mengakses lembar kerja tertentu tempat kita akan menambahkan data. Untuk mempermudah, kita akan menggunakan lembar kerja pertama dalam buku kerja.
Worksheet worksheet = workbook.Worksheets[0];
Kalimat ini seperti mengambil kanvas kosong untuk mulai melukis karya agung Anda!
Langkah 6: Mengakses Sel di Lembar Kerja
Untuk contoh ini, mari kita masukkan teks ke dalam sel “A1”. Kita dapat mengakses sel ini secara langsung untuk memanipulasi isinya.
Aspose.Cells.Cell cell = worksheet.Cells["A1"];
Langkah ini memungkinkan kita berinteraksi dengan sel individual, bukan dengan keseluruhan lembar kerja.
Langkah 7: Tambahkan Nilai ke Sel
Sekarang, mari tambahkan beberapa konten aktual ke sel yang kita pilih.
cell.PutValue("Visit Aspose!");
Di sini, kita cukup meletakkan teks “Kunjungi Aspose!” ke dalam sel A1. Anda dapat mengubahnya ke konten apa pun yang Anda inginkan.
Langkah 8: Dapatkan Gaya Sel
Untuk menerapkan indentasi, pertama-tama kita perlu mengambil gaya sel saat ini. Ini akan memungkinkan kita untuk mengubah properti tanpa kehilangan format yang ada.
Style style = cell.GetStyle();
Anggap saja ini seperti memeriksa sapuan kuas saat ini di kanvas Anda sebelum Anda menambahkan sapuan kuas baru.
Langkah 9: Mengatur Tingkat Indentasi
Selanjutnya, mari kita atur tingkat indentasi. Ini adalah inti dari tutorial kita – menambahkan sentuhan hierarki visual ke konten sel kita.
style.IndentLevel = 2;
Di sini, kami menetapkan tingkat indentasi ke 2, artinya teks dalam sel akan diimbangi dari margin kiri, membuatnya menonjol.
Langkah 10: Terapkan Gaya Kembali ke Sel
Setelah kita mengonfigurasi gaya, kita perlu menerapkannya kembali ke sel kita untuk melihat perubahannya.
cell.SetStyle(style);
Langkah ini penting; seperti menyegel karya agung Anda setelah Anda selesai melukis!
Langkah 11: Simpan File Excel
Terakhir, mari kita simpan buku kerja kita ke direktori yang ditentukan. Kita akan menyimpannya dalam format yang kompatibel dengan versi Excel yang lebih lama.
workbook.Save(dataDir + "book1.out.xls", SaveFormat.Excel97To2003);
Di sinilah semuanya menjadi satu! Buku kerja disimpan, dan kini Anda dapat melihatnya di Excel.
Kesimpulan
Nah, itu dia! Anda telah mempelajari cara mengonfigurasi pengaturan indentasi di Excel menggunakan Aspose.Cells untuk .NET. Dengan mengikuti langkah-langkah sederhana ini, Anda dapat meningkatkan kejelasan visual lembar kerja Anda secara signifikan, menjadikan data Anda tidak hanya fungsional, tetapi juga elegan. Apakah Anda seorang pengembang yang ingin menyederhanakan proses pelaporan atau seorang penghobi yang gemar dengan lembar kerja, menguasai teknik-teknik ini dapat membuat pengalaman Excel Anda menjadi mudah!
Pertanyaan yang Sering Diajukan
Apa itu Aspose.Cells?
Aspose.Cells adalah pustaka .NET untuk membuat, memodifikasi, dan mengonversi file Excel secara terprogram tanpa perlu menginstal Microsoft Excel.
Bisakah saya menggunakan Aspose.Cells di Linux?
Ya, Aspose.Cells mendukung .NET Core, sehingga Anda dapat menggunakannya di lingkungan Linux juga.
Bagaimana saya bisa mendapatkan versi uji coba gratis?
Anda dapat mengunduh versi uji coba gratis dariSitus Aspose.
Apakah Aspose.Cells kompatibel dengan semua versi Excel?
Aspose.Cells mendukung berbagai format Excel, termasuk versi lama seperti Excel 97-2003.
Di mana saya dapat menemukan dokumentasi lebih lanjut?
Anda dapat menemukan dokumentasi lengkap diHalaman referensi Aspose.